Elements of Competency Performance Criteria              
Element: Identify all sources and uses of energy in process
  • Identify all sources of energy external to the site
  • Identify all sources of energy within the site
  • Consult with technical, operational and other relevant stakeholders to identify all uses of energy, energy type and intensity required by plant and/or equipment within process
       
Element: Calculate theoretical use of energy
  • Calculate theoretical net use of energy by type and intensity for plant and/or equipment
  • Calculate overall energy balance for process
  • Evaluate the need for energy consumption by process compared to alternative processes, plant and/or equipment
       
Element: Measure actual use of energy
  • Determine actual net energy use for overall process
  • Determine actual net energy use for plant and/or equipment within process
  • Calculate difference between theoretical and actual energy use by plant and/or equipment and overall process
  • Identify actual energy type used by plant and/or equipment
       
Element: Develop strategies to improve energy usage
  • Rank plant and/or equipment by difference between theoretical and actual energy use
  • Rank plant and/or equipment by actual energy use
  • Identify plant and/or equipment using higher intensity energy than required
  • Develop strategies to reduce energy consumption and/or use lower intensity energy
       
Element: Prepare recommendation/s for improved energy usage
  • Consult with stakeholders to confirm or amend strategies
  • Identify any regulatory or other requirements that impact energy usage and amend strategies as needed to address requirements
  • Rank strategies by benefit/cost ratio
  • Short-list preferred energy reduction strategies
  • Prepare recommendation/s according to procedures and requirements for approval
